BTB3 is £752.91 plus VAT and shipping, this was a quote I got last week, doesn't include the down pipe (2 into 2), that's another £354.25 plus VAT and shipping!
I tried to get the BTB2 to clear using E28 M5 engine mounts, a DanThe steering linkage and shaved down steering UJs and it was to close for comfort and I didn't like the height or angle it was making the engine sit at.
